ul.tabsInnerRight { /*float: left;*/ list-style: none; height: 32px; /*--Set height of tabs--*/ border-bottom: 1px solid #e0e0e0; border-left: 1px solid #e0e0e0; width: 100%; margin:0 auto; } ul.tabsInnerRight li { float: left; height: 31px; /*--Subtract 1px from the height of the unordered list--*/ line-height: 31px; /*--Vertically aligns the text within the tab--*/ border: 1px solid #e0e0e0; border-left: none; margin-bottom: -1px; /*--Pull the list item down 1px--*/ overflow: hidden; position: relative; background: #FFF; } ul.tabsInnerRight li a { text-decoration: none; color: #FFB80F; display: block; font-size: 14px; padding: 0 20px; border: 1px solid #fff; /*--Gives the bevel look with a 1px white border inside the list item--*/ outline: none; } ul.tabsInnerRight li a:hover { background: #f2f2f2; } html ul.tabsInnerRight li.active, html ul.tabsInnerRight li.active a:hover { /*--Makes sure that the active tab does not listen to the hover properties--*/ background: #fff; border-bottom: 1px solid #fff; /*--Makes the active tab look like it's connected with its content--*/ } .tab_container { border:1px solid #e0e0e0; border-top: none; overflow: hidden; clear: both; float: left; width: 100%; background: #fff; } .tab_content { padding: 20px; font-size: 14px; } .tabTitle { padding-top:20px; padding-bottom:20px; padding-left:10px; font-size:18px; background-color:#e3e3e3; margin-bottom:6px; } .session { margin-top:8px; margin-bottom:8px; } .sessionTitle { color:#FF8400; font-weight:bold; cursor:pointer;} .sessionChild { display:none;} .talkIcon a { text-decoration:none; } .talks { font-weight:bold; } .talks li {margin-bottom:3px;} .pName a, .readingMatTitle a { color:#FF8400; text-decoration:none;} .objWrapper { margin-bottom:8px; } .pBio { margin-bottom:8px; display:none;}